Research Overview PT-141 is the research name commonly used for bremelanotide, a synthetic cyclic heptapeptide and melanocortin-receptor agonist derived from melanotan II research

Published research on GLP-1 receptor agonists has consistently reported measurable effects on body weight in clinical trial settings, with one widely cited 68-week trial reporting average body weight reductions exceeding 14% among study participants a substantially larger and more consistently reproduced effect size than has been documented for growth hormone fragment peptides like AOD-9604
